The Expanding Role of Proteomics in Understanding Human Biology
Proteomics has become one of the most transformative scientific fields because it allows researchers to examine life at the level where the real biological work happens.
Unlike genes, which represent static instructions, proteins are dynamic molecules that change constantly depending on health, age, environment, and disease conditions. Every cell depends on proteins to carry out essential functions, from metabolism and immune defense to structural support, signaling, and repair. By studying proteomics, scientists gain a detailed understanding of how these molecules behave in normal states and how they malfunction in disease. This level of insight enables the mapping of complex biological processes and reveals connections that are invisible through genetic analysis alone. Proteomics helps identify which proteins are active, where they are located, how they interact with one another, and how slight changes in their concentration or structure can lead to major physiological consequences.
